Description

Essential Job Functions

The following duties are normal for this position. The incumbent may perform some or all of these duties however; it is not an exclusive or all-inclusive list. Other duties may be assigned.

  • Implements operational strategies in assigned area(s) to assure company objectives in the areas of safety, productivity, quality, customer service, sales, human capital, cost and profitability
  • Accountable for assigned area's key performance metrics including machine and labor efficiencies and provides guidance to production associates to ensure scorecard objectives are met
  • Supports capacity planning process to meet internal and external customer on-time-delivery demands
  • Collaborates with cross-functional leaders to support continuous improvement initiatives to drive operational excellence
  • Provides guidance on staffing, training, employee relations and performance management to develop and enhance the salaried and hourly production team, working closely with direct reports
  • Interacts with key stakeholders to provide technical support and/or resolve order problems or complaints
  • Maintains industry, professional and technical knowledge by networking, attending industry events, and reviewing professional publications

Education & Experience

  • High School diploma required, Bachelor's degree preferred
  • Minimum of 4 years of relevant experience required

Knowledge, Skills & Abilities

  • Knowledge of and ability to use and influence organization's policies, standards and procedures guiding manufacturing processes
  • Knowledge of methods, accepted practices, considerations and regulatory requirements associated with safety and protection of workers, environment and site
  • Knowledge of the existing and planned approaches and methods for manufacturing products or product components
  • Knowledge of day-to-day and strategic issues, operational requirements and management of a manufacturing facility
  • Knowledge of the day-to-day operations of a manufacturing plant or facility
  • Knowledge of technologies and applications used in manufacturing products and in the optimization of manufacturing processes

Physical Requirements & Work Environment

  • Primarily works in a production and/or warehouse setting with time also spent in an office setting
  • Frequent walking and standing required
  • Occasional travel may be required
  • Occasional lifting up to 25 lbs.
